Gruyere Rings

6 ingredients
11 steps

Ingredients

  • 34 cup whole milk
  • 12 teaspoon salt
  • 14 cup unsalted butter
  • 23 cup all-purpose flour
  • 2 large eggs
  • 4 ounces gruyere cheese, grated (approx. 1 1/4cups)

Directions

  1. 1
    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
  2. 2
    Make choux pastry: Bring milk, salt and butter to a boil.
  3. 3
    Remove from heat.
  4. 4
    Add flour and beat with a wooden spoon until dough starts to leave the bottom of the pan and forms into a ball.
  5. 5
    Cool slightly.
  6. 6
    Beat in eggs one at a time and then beat until dough becomes shiny but is still sticky.
  7. 7
    Stir half of the Gruyere Cheese into the choux pastry.
  8. 8
    Spoon dough into a pastry bag (or Ziploc Bag with the corner sipped off) and pipe onto a baking sheet lined with parchment paper in rings of about 2 inches in diameter.
  9. 9
    Sprinkle remaining cheese on top of rings.
  10. 10
    Bake for 25-30 minutes.
  11. 11
    Transfer to cooling rack.
